Ermi Testing Questions
What is ERMI testing? ERMI testing analyzes dust samples to identify the presence of mold DNA, helping determine mold contamination levels inside a property.
When should property owners consider ERMI testing? ERMI testing is useful when there are signs of mold issues, unexplained allergies, or after water damage to assess indoor mold levels.
What types of properties benefit from ERMI testing? Residential homes, rental properties, and commercial buildings can benefit from ERMI testing to evaluate indoor air quality and mold risks.
How does ERMI testing help property owners? It provides information about mold presence and types, aiding in decision-making for remediation or further inspection efforts.
